Dr. Yaron Baruchim, DVM, IVIMS, Dip-ACVECC, Dip-ECVECC.
Diplomate of the American and European College of Emergency and critical Care.
Dr. Yaron Baruchim has graduate from The Koret School of Veterinary Medicine, The Hebrew University of Jerusalem, Israel in 1999. In 2000 he completed his internship year. In 2003-2007 he did his Israeli residencey in small animal internal medicine. During the years 2009-2012 he did is residency in emergency medicine and critical care of the American College. In the years 2017 – 2014 he completed his doctorate on heat acclimation and heat resistance in working dogs. In addition to his work at the hospital, Dr. Baruchim is a senior lecturer at the Hebrew University.
Major research interests include heat stroke, snake bites, ventilation, GDV and coagulation disorders of pets.
Today he is a diplomat of the American and Europian College of Emergency Medicine and Critical Care, and serves as a member of the European College Committees.
